The projected annual HIV incidence rate per 100 person-years for ART eligibility (CD4 ≤350 cells/µL: solid; CD4 ≤500 cells/µL: dashed; all HIV-positive: dotted) and health access strategies (status quo: red; expanded access: blue). In the generalized epidemic settings (South Africa, Zambia), ‘expanded access’ refers to expanded access for the general population. In concentrated epidemic settings (India, Vietnam), ‘expanded access’ refers to expanded access for all high-risk groups (FSW, MSM, PWID; see Table 1).
